The Advantages of a Ceramic Coffee Grinder

Ceramic grinders are well-known for their longevity and durability. They are more durable than steel blades, and they don't rust when exposed to temperatures that are high. However, they are not as sharp as stainless steel.

All ceramics begin as a powder or clay which is then mixed with water to form an adhesive. The final shape of the clay is then pressed. The "green" ceramics that result are soft and difficult for machines to handle, so they need to be "sinterned" or fired to harden. Then, they can be machined relatively easily.

Ceramics are used in a variety of applications, from semiconductors to surgical devices. They are usually constructed from zirconia which is extremely strong and hard. Zirconia components can be produced using a number of methods including laser cutting, scribing, breaking, and mechanical machining. The components can be polished and inspected to determine the microstructure of the inside. This way, the exact properties of the ceramic can be determined.

The history of nonstick coatings goes to the beginning of Greek cooking equipment. Archeologists have discovered pots with a coating to stop dough from sticking. However, the modern nonstick coating was accidentally discovered in 1938 when a Chemours employee named Roy Plunkett accidentally created polytetrafluoroethylene (PTFE). This high-density, heat-resistant chemical compound has a unique property: it resists the formation of oil droplets on its surface. It was trademarked Teflon and was first used in cookware as early as the 1960s.

Easy to clean

Ceramic grinders are easier to maintain than steel ones, as they don't retain oil and are less likely to heat buildup. Even ceramic grinders require regular cleaning to maintain their working condition. To avoid a sticky mess you should clean your grinder at least once a week. This will keep it clear of dirt and will not alter the flavor or smell of your marijuana.

Take off the lid, hopper and any gaskets that can be removed. These components should be washed with hot soapy water, and then rinsed well. After cleaning your grinder, you can use the brush to scrub its burrs and interior areas. Rinse and dry the machine thoroughly to prevent corrosion.

Ideally you should use a hard brush or paintbrush to remove stubborn gunk from the hard-to-reach areas of your grinder. Use the attachment of a vacuum cleaner or hose to clean any remaining remnants.
